Subject: 2021 Family Week

By now you have probably seen information sent out to superintendents and high school principals as well as local media outlets regarding the inaugural “Family Week” which will take place this summer from July 25th through August 1st. It will be the corresponding week moving into the future. This has been a process lasting over 2 years and information was shared in the fall regarding the implementation. The Iowa Girls High School Athletic Union, the Iowa High School Speech Association and the Iowa High Schol Music Association will also be implementing this program. At this time, those schools participating in the state baseball tournament will be exempt due to the dates of the tournament. Next year, with baseball moving ahead one week, there will be no conflicts.

Just to clarify, this family week is only in effect for students in grades 9 through 12. Meaning 9th grade students for the 2021-2022 school year through those students who will be seniors during the 2021-2022 school year.

There are no restrictions on students who will be in 8th grade and below, however, high school students cannot be “counselors” at these camps and it is recommended that all facilities on your campus be shut down during this 8 day period.

Below is a link to the IHSAA’s release on the upcoming Family Week, starting this summer on the IHSAA and IGHSAU calendar.

The short version of Family Week’s contact rules: No intentional or scheduled contact between any student-athlete and coach from their school at any place, at any time, and for any purpose during the prohibited period.
